Stereophonics at Sheffield's FlyDSA Arena: Important security information released

Following the release of their sixth number one album, former Tramlines headliners Stereophonics return to Sheffield this Friday.

Kelly Jones and Co. will kick off their latest nationwide tour with a show at the city’s FlyDSA Arena, with American band The Wind and The Wave supporting them.

The Welsh band have sold 8.5 million albums sold in the UK alone, and have no fewer than five BRIT Award nominations.

Friday’s show is the first in a series of stadium shows, which includes dates in London and Glasgow, as well as a sold-out double-header at Cardiff’s Motorpoint Arena.

Ahead of the event, the venue has released security information for fans.

Bags larger than A3 size (about 40cm x 35cm x 19cm) are not allowed inside – and personal belongings should be kept to a minimum to avoid additional searches and delays to entrance.

There will be no access to the venue’s car parks without a ticket, which can be pre-purchased online or upon arrival. Drop-offs and pick-ups are also not allowed in the venue’s car parks.

Gig-goers may be searched before they are allowed inside. People are therefore asked to arrive promptly when doors open at 6.30pm to avoid delays.

Smoke bombs, flares or any other pyrotechnic article are forbidden. Anyone attempting to bring these items into the Arena will be refused entry.

The Arena is now a cashless venue and only takes card payments for on-site parking and at food & drink outlets.
